The answer begins with “collateral.” In the old world, if you wanted to borrow from a bank, you’d show proof of income, a steady job, a good credit score. In DeFi, you lock a crypto asset in a smart contract. That locked asset is your collateral. The contract then mints a stable‑coin or liquid‑yield token that you can use elsewhere. What is a Collateral‑Backed Position?

A Collateral‑Backed Position, or CDP (Collateralized Debt Position), is the building block of many DeFi lending protocols. In practice, a CDP is a smart‑contract wallet that holds one or more collateral tokens and issues debt tokens against it. The debt token is usually a stable‑coin pegged to the U.S. dollar, like DAI. This means you can borrow dollars in the form of a cryptocurrency that strives to stay close to $1.

The relationship is governed by a collateralization ratio. Suppose we set a ratio of 150 %. For every $150 worth of collateral, you can borrow $100 worth of debt. That buffer is there because crypto prices move like waves; a sudden drop in collateral value could erase your deposit. The protocol keeps you safe by requiring that the value of your debt never exceeds the stipulated percentage of the value of your collateral.

You might wonder how the protocol knows the price of your collaterals? It relies on oracles that aggregate price feeds from multiple sources.
